Title :
Efficient access to Web services
Author :
Ouzzani, Mourad ; Bouguettaya, Athman
Author_Institution :
Virginia Tech, VA, USA
Abstract :
For Web services to expand across the Internet, users need to be able to efficiently access and share Web services. The authors present a query infrastructure that treats Web services as first-class objects. It evaluates queries through the invocations of different Web service operations. Because efficiency plays a central role in such evaluations, the authors propose a query optimization model based on aggregating the quality of Web service (QoWS) parameters of different Web services. The model adjusts QoWS through a dynamic rating scheme and multilevel matching in which the rating provides an assessment of Web services´ behavior. Multilevel matching allows the expansion of the solution space by enabling similar and partial answers.
